Course Number: MN 3020-30
Title: African American Church Management
Author: Floyd H. Flake
Category: Theology & Ministry
Qualifies for: Apostolic Concentration
TB - Text Book Course
Credit Hours: 3hrs
This resource covers virtually every aspect of church administration. It is for for black churches of any denomination and any size, and is designed to provide guidance for new or established pastors. A simple constitution, budget, and mission statement are included. The book addresses: Characteristics of African American Churches, daily operations, worship planning, leadership styles, managing people, managing money, legal issues, and community and economic developement.
